ASR Vermogensbeheer N.V. raised its holdings in NIKE, Inc. (NYSE:NKE - Free Report) by 7.4% in the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The firm owned 585,435 shares of the footwear maker's stock after acquiring an additional 40,564 shares during the quarter. ASR Vermogensbeheer N.V.'s holdings in NIKE were worth $41,587,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

NIKE Stock Performance

NKE stock opened at $74.04 on Thursday. The company has a current ratio of 2.21, a quick ratio of 1.50 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.60. The firm has a market cap of $109.35 billion, a P/E ratio of 37.97, a P/E/G ratio of 2.60 and a beta of 1.29. NIKE, Inc. has a 12-month low of $52.28 and a 12-month high of $85.23. The stock's 50 day simple moving average is $74.73 and its 200 day simple moving average is $67.31.

NIKE (NYSE:NKE -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, September 30th. The footwear maker reported $0.49 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.27 by $0.22. The business had revenue of $11.72 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$10.96 billion. NIKE had a return on equity of 21.05% and a net margin of 6.23%.The business's revenue was up 1.0%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ted $0.70 EPS. As a group, equities research analysts predict that NIKE, Inc. will post 2.05 EPS for the current year.

NIKE Announces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, October 1st. Investors of record on Tuesday, September 2nd were paid a dividend of $0.40 per share. This represents a $1.60 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.2%. The ex-dividend date was Tuesday, September 2nd. NIKE's dividend payout ratio is presently 74.07%.

NIKE Profile

(Free Report)

NIKE,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, markets, and sells athletic footwear, apparel, equipment, accessories, and services worldwide. The company provides athletic and casual footwear, apparel, and accessories under the Jumpman trademark; and casual sneakers, apparel, and accessories under the Converse, Chuck Taylor, All Star, One Star, Star Chevron, and Jack Purcell trademarks.
